Vörösmarty Classic Xmas
đ Vörösmarty Square, District V
đ 14 November â 31 December 2025
đ SunâThu 11:00â21:00; FriâSat 11:00â22:00;
24 Dec 10:00â14:00; 25â26 Dec 12:00â18:00; 31 Dec 11:00â18:00
The heart of Budapestâs festive season beats at Vörösmarty Classic Xmas, one of the oldest and most beloved Christmas fairs in Central Europe. With its charming wooden stalls, live folk performances, and glittering decorations, it perfectly captures the spirit of the season.
Highlight: The miniature Christmas train â a delightful ride that winds around the square and fills children (and adults!) with joy.
Stroll among Hungarian artisansâ stands, admire the giant Christmas tree, and take in the atmosphere as the scent of pine and cinnamon fills the air. This market is the cityâs warm, traditional heart â festive, authentic, and endlessly photogenic.
Advent Bazilika
đ St. Stephenâs Square, District V
đ 15 November 2025 â 1 January 2026
đ MonâThu 11:30â22:00; Fri & Sat 11:00â23:00; Sun 11:00â22:00
(Closed 24 Dec, limited opening 25â26 Dec 12:00â18:00)
For the fourth year in a row, Advent Bazilika has been voted Europeâs most beautiful Christmas market, and it truly lives up to its reputation again this year. Nearly a hundred Hungarian artisans fill the square with handmade gifts, light displays illuminate the Basilica, and festive music creates an unforgettable atmosphere.
Highlight: The 3D light show projected on the Basilica â a mesmerizing performance that brings Christmas stories to life every evening.
Visitors can browse unique crafts, enjoy concerts and some great Hungarian cuisine. Soak up the magical ambience surrounded by one of Budapestâs most iconic landmarks!
Budapest Christmas Market at VĂĄroshĂĄza Park
đ VĂĄroshĂĄza Park (City Hall Park), District V
đ 14 November 2025 â 4 January 2026
đ Official page
Budapestâs newest and most dynamic Christmas experience, held right beside City Hall, blends classic market charm with modern festive attractions. Itâs especially family-friendly, with plenty of activities for kids and beautiful decorations for every age to enjoy.
Highlights:
-
The Santa Claus Trolley, rolling through downtown Budapest and spreading Christmas cheer.
-
A phenomenal light show that transforms the park with vibrant colours and joyful energy.
VĂĄroshĂĄza Park also features an ice rink (actually an ice rink corridor) and creative artisan stalls. Don’t miss the interactive installations â making it one of the most exciting winter experiences in Budapest this year.
